Planning Your Visit

Finding the Mosaics

Locating the Roman Mosaics Petrovac requires a short trek. Follow the dirt path from St. Thomas Church, passing an off-road car park. The mosaics are visible through glass, offering a glimpse into history.

Check Opening Hours

The Roman Mosaics Petrovac has limited opening hours, typically Monday to Friday, 10:00 to 14:00. It's often closed, so confirm availability before your visit to avoid disappointment.

Discovering the Roman Heritage

The Roman Mosaics Petrovac are remnants of a Roman villa, offering a tangible connection to the area's ancient past. These preserved mosaic floors are a testament to the craftsmanship of the era. The site is designed to protect these delicate artworks from the elements, with the mosaics visible through protective glass. This ensures that future generations can also appreciate this historical find. Reddit

While the site itself might be small, its significance lies in its historical context. It provides a glimpse into the lives of those who inhabited this region centuries ago. For history enthusiasts, it's a chance to see archaeological evidence firsthand. However, it's important to manage expectations, as the site is not a large-scale excavation but rather a preserved section of a former villa. Reddit
